Legal Internship Opportunity at Chaubey & Company (1 Month): Apply Now!

Vikash Sankhala
3 Min Read

Chaubey & Company is inviting applications from law students for a one-month legal internship commencing in May 2026.

About Chaubey & Company

Chaubey & Company is a litigation-focused legal practice engaged in handling matters relating to dispute resolution, court procedures, and legal drafting before appropriate judicial forums. The chamber regularly undertakes work involving preparation of pleadings, filing procedures, case documentation, and legal research connected with ongoing litigation matters.

The office supports clients across different stages of proceedings and provides assistance in drafting notices, applications, and supporting legal documents required for effective case presentation. Through chamber-based assignments and supervised research tasks, interns gain familiarity with procedural requirements and documentation practices followed in active litigation environments.

The internship structure enables law students to observe how litigation files are prepared, reviewed, and progressed before courts, while also developing an understanding of professional drafting standards followed in chamber practice.

About the Internship

The internship at Chaubey & Company is designed to provide practical exposure to litigation practice, dispute resolution work, and drafting-related assignments. Selected interns will assist with legal research, preparation of pleadings and applications, and compilation of supporting materials relevant to ongoing matters handled by the chamber.

Interns may also observe court procedures and filing requirements, analyse case laws connected with assigned research areas, and assist with documentation review related to active disputes. Exposure to such assignments helps participants understand procedural workflows involved in litigation support work.

Participants may additionally be involved in preparation of research summaries and drafting assistance relating to notices and applications, subject to the requirements of the chamber. The internship is intended to familiarise students with structured litigation support responsibilities and expectations within professional chamber environments.

Eligibility Criteria

Law students currently in the fourth or fifth year of a five-year integrated law degree programme are encouraged to apply. Preference may be given to candidates who have prior internship experience in litigation offices or law firms. Applicants are expected to possess strong research, drafting, and communication skills along with demonstrated interest in litigation practice.

Mode

This is an in-office internship at the chamber.

Location

The internship will be conducted at the chamber office.

Duration

The duration of the internship is one month.

Applications must be submitted by sending an updated CV to the official application email address provided below. Applicants are required to mention “Internship Application – May” in the subject line of the email while submitting their application.
